Without further ado, here is the free crochet pattern for Bernie's Mittens:
Materials:
  • RED HEART Coffee (A) or Dark Brown – 1 Skein
  • RED HEART Café Late (B) or Light Brown – 1 Skein
  • RED HEART Buff (C) or Tan – 1 Skein
  • RED HEART Aran (D) or Ivory – 1 Skein
  • Size H (5 mm) Crochet Hook
  • Tapestry Needle

Abbreviations:
  • Ch- Chain
  • Sc- Single Crochet
  • St- Stitch
  • Sl st- Slip Stitch
  • Sc Dec- Single Crochet Decrease

Notes:
  • This is a unisex design. I wanted hands of all sizes to fit inside these mittens, so they may be on the larger side for some.
  • When seaming, I seam over the corners to give it the rounded effect. I also leave the corners tucked in when I turn it right-side out if it still looks too boxy.
  • The wrong-side is simply the side that will face inside the mittens. I usually leave all my tails on this side
Bernie's Mittens Free Crochet Pattern:
With A, ch 41
Row 1: In 2nd ch from hook, sc, sc in every ch across, turn (40)
Row 2: Ch 1, sc in every st across, turn (40)
Row 2-4: Repeat row 2
Row 5: Switch to B, ch 1, sc in every st across, turn (40)
Row 6-10: Repeat row 5
Row 11: 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 2 st, *with D, 1 sc in next st, with B,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with D, 1 sc in next st, with B, 1 sc in next st, turn, (40)
Row 12: With B,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 2 st, *with D, 1 sc in next st, with B,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with D, 1 sc in next st, with B,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 13: With D,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, *with B, 1 sc in next st, with D,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with  B,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 14: With B, ch 1, 1 sc in next st, with D,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, *with B, 1 sc in next st, with D,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, turn (40)
Row 15: With D, ch 1, 1 sc in next st, *with C, 1 sc in next st, with D,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with C, 1 sc in next st, with D, 1 sc in each of the next 2 st, turn (40)
Row 16: With D,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 2 st, *with C, 1 sc in next st, with D,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with C 1 sc in next st, with D 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 17: With C,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, *with D, 1 sc in next st, with C,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with D,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 18: With D, ch 1, 1 sc in next st, with C,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, *with D, 1 sc in next st, with C,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, turn (40)
Row 19: With C, ch 1, 1 sc in next st, *with A, 1 sc in next st, with C,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with A, 1 sc in next st, with C, 1 sc in each of the next 2 st, turn (40)
Row 20: With C, 1 sc in each of the next 2 st, *with A, 1 sc in next st, with C,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with A, 1 sc in next st, with C,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 21: With A,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, *with C, 1 sc in next st, with A,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to *8 more times, with C,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 22: With C, 1 sc in next st, with A,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, *with C, 1 sc in next st, with A,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, turn (40)
Row 23: With A, ch 1, 1 sc in next st, 1 sc in every st across (40)
Row 24: With A, ch 1, 1 sc in next st, with B, 1 sc in next st, *with A, 1 sc in next st, with B,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 18 more times, turn (40)
Row 25: With B, ch 1, 1 sc in next st, 1 sc in every st across, turn (40)
Row 26-28: Repeat row 25
Row 29: With B,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 2 st, with D, 1 sc in next st, *with B,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with D,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with B,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 30: With D,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with B, 1 sc in next st, *with D,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with B,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with B,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 31: With B, 1 sc in each of the next 2 st, with D, 1 sc in next st, *with B,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with D,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with B,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 32-35: Repeat row 25
Row 36: With A, ch 1, 1 sc in next st, with B, 1 sc in next st, *with A, 1 sc in next st, with B,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 18 more times, turn (40)
Row 37: Repeat row 23
Row 38: With A,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with C, 1 sc in next st, *with A,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with C,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, turn (40)
Row 39: With C, ch 1, 1 sc in next st, with A, 1 sc in next st, *with C,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with a,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with C,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 40: With C,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with B, 1 sc in next st, *with C,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with B,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, turn (40)
Row 41: With B,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 2 st, with C, 1 sc in next st, *with B,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with C,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with B,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 42: With C,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with B, 1 sc in next st, *with C,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with B, 1 sc I next st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, turn (40)
Row 43: With C,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 2 st, with D, 1 sc in next st, *with C,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with D, 1 sc in next st, * repeat from * to * 8 more times, with C,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 44: With D,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with C, 1 sc in next st, *with D,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with C,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, turn (40)
Row 45: With D,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 2 st, with B, 1 sc in next st, *with D,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with B,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, with D, 1 sc in next st, turn (40)
Row 46: With B, ch 1,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with D, 1 sc in next st, *with B, 1 sc in each of the next 3 st, with D, 1 sc in next st,* repeat from * to * 8 more times, turn (40)
 
Fold with the wrong side facing out. With a tapestry needle, stitch the sides together going across the top and halfway down the side. Cut and tie off. Then, begin stitching the rest of the way down the side starting around row 17 and ending at the bottom of the side. Leave the bottom completely open. Cut and tie off.
 
Thumb
Turn so the right side is facing out. Work in the round.
Row 1: With A, attach yarn to the top of the thumb hole with a sl st, ch 1, sc evenly around thumb hole, do not sl st (18)
Row 2: Sc in every st around (18)
Row 3: Repeat row 2
Row 4: Sc down one side of the thumb hole, at the bottom of the thumb hole, sc dec, sc up the other side of the thumb hole (17)
Row 5-11: Repeat row 4 (10)
Row 12: 3 sc dec around (5)
Cut yarn. Seam up the tip of the thumb. Hide tails
